    ATLAS.ti (www.atlasti.com) is very common for qualitative research. We use it here in Bern and I know several other institutions in German-speaking Europe that use it as well. Atlas is quite OK regarding its functions. But ATLAS is just a tool. Do not overestimate it. Most of the work is thinking. I am not familiar with Nvivo. But all in all the software should fit your workflow. Therefore I recommend to use both as trial versions or at other universities to see which of them fits your needs.

    At Vlerick Management School we are currently performing qualitative longitudinal case study research regarding business models. I was wondering if anybody in this audience has experience with software to organize and analyze qualitative data of different kinds. I have been looking at Atlas and QRS Nvivo amongst others. If this sounds familiar one way or another:

    . What software do you know?
    . What was your experience with this software?
